The 2015 BNP Paribas Open began this weekend in Indian Wells. The event, voted the best tournament in 2014 by the players, features the world’s top ranked tennis players. Serena Williams, the enigmatic number one ranked woman, reappeared after a fourteen year hiatus. The men’s top seeds, Novac Djokovic, Roger Federer and Rafael Nadal advanced as did  Serena Williams, Maria Sharapova and Ana Ivanovic on the lady’s side. Orange County tennis players and fans, and an especially large contingent of Palisades Tennis Club members, turned out for the first weekend. The tournament, attended by over 430,000 fans last year,  is the largest event in the desert.  The winners take home checks for $1 million.
